This Morning at about 10:30, Anthony Miller and myself located the
Flycatcher, thanks to the help of Jim Heslop, the only other birder we
encountered all morning. The Flycatcher is now foraging along the trees and
shrubs that border the pond, which is directly across the field from where
birders usually park. If you head for the pond, check out the pines and
brushy areas that border the pond.....hope this helps, Tom Thomas.
     Directions....From # 3 H. West of Cayuga, turn right on River Road, and
drive a couple of Kilometers to Indiana Road West, turn left and drive 1.8
Kilometers, and the Flycatcher was found across the field on your left.
